Description
Enjoy perfectly cooked, fluffy air fryer baked potatoes with a crispy skin in under 45 minutes. This simple recipe uses minimal ingredients and the air fryer to deliver a delicious side dish or snack with a beautifully tender interior and golden exterior.
Ingredients
Scale
Potatoes
- 4 medium russet potatoes
Seasoning
- Olive oil or cooking spray, as needed
- Salt, to taste
Instructions
- Prepare Potatoes: Poke each potato several times with a fork to allow steam to escape during cooking, preventing bursting.
- Season: Lightly coat each potato with olive oil or cooking spray, then sprinkle evenly with salt to taste for enhanced flavor and crispy skin.
- Preheat Air Fryer: Set your air fryer to 400°F (200°C) and allow it to reach temperature for even cooking.
- Cook Potatoes: Place the potatoes in the air fryer basket, ensuring they don’t touch each other. Cook for 30-40 minutes, checking at 30 minutes for softness by inserting a fork. If needed, continue cooking in 5-minute increments until the potatoes are tender inside.
- Serve: Remove the potatoes from the air fryer carefully. Slice each potato open and fluff the interior with a fork before serving.
Notes
- Russet potatoes work best due to their starchy texture that creates a fluffy interior.
- Adjust cooking time based on potato size; larger potatoes may need longer cooking.
- You can add toppings like butter, sour cream, cheese, or chives after cooking for extra flavor.
- Do not overcrowd the air fryer basket to ensure even cooking.
- Be cautious when handling hot potatoes after air frying to avoid burns.
